1. Road work on Flagler is mostly finished, and now merchants are hoping their businesses recover 

https://infoweb-newsbank-com.lp.hscl.ufl.edu/apps/news/document-view?p=WORLDNEWS&t=pubname%3AMIHB%21Miami%2BHerald%252C%2BThe%2B%2528FL%2529/year%3A2019%212019/mody%3A0117%21January%2B17&f=advanced&action=browse&format=text&docref=news/171055B9BAC987B0

In Miami, there is a street (Flagler Street) that has been under construction for over two years. Businesses have lost money and some have even had to shut down. This has created a major problem for the business owners. The business owners thought the construction would be done quick, never did they expect it to go on for years. A salon owner talks about how he had savings but now he has run out. He has had this business for 16 years and he is nervous that the salon will have to shut down. Thankfully, the construction is almost done. All the pipes have been fixed and part of the street already have new roads and bike lanes.

3. More than 68,000 pounds of chicken recalled after wood was found by some customers

https://infoweb-newsbank-com.lp.hscl.ufl.edu/apps/news/document-view?p=WORLDNEWS&t=pubname%3AMIHB%21Miami%2BHerald%252C%2BThe%2B%2528FL%2529/year%3A2019%212019/mody%3A0119%21January%2B19&f=advanced&action=browse&format=text&docref=news/1710FDC49C6E2AF0

Three customers found wood in their chicken breast after purchasing. The company Perdue is in trouble because of this and decided to have a recall. The Simply Organic Gluten Free chicken had a recall starting on Thursday, January 17. Over 68,000 pounds of chicken were recalled and the company was able to track the production back to October. Perdue is returning the money for the all the customers that had a problem with their chicken. 

4.  California man used Instagram to threaten friends, family of Parkland tragedy, FBI says

https://infoweb-newsbank-com.lp.hscl.ufl.edu/apps/news/document-view?p=WORLDNEWS&t=pubname%3AMIHB%21Miami%2BHerald%252C%2BThe%2B%2528FL%2529/year%3A2019%212019/mody%3A0122%21January%2B22&f=advanced&action=browse&format=text&docref=news/17121EC964E5C530

A California man, Brandon Fleury, went on Instagram to harass and intimidate family members and friends of the victims. Fleury is being charged of cyber threats such as kidnapping and harassment. He will be going to federal court in Fort Lauderdale. Although he is from California, he was threatening people in Florida, so he is being charged in Florida in the federal court system.
